DUNWOODY, Ga. - Police in Georgia are warning parents about a social media food challenge that has left at least one student needing medical treatment. The Dunwoody Police Department issued a warning about the One Chip Challenge after a Dunwoody High School student became injured after accepting the challenge. The viral challenge, which originally started in 2016 as a marking campaign by the tortilla chip company Paqui, has led to bas in schools across the country. In the challenge, participants by a single chip, which is flavored with extremely hot peppers.
